Okay so lets look at this.
So we have 5/5 girls.
2/5 of them are playing softball. An equal number of girls signed up to play pitcher, infield, and outfield. This means that each one is 1/3.
So out of 2/5 of the girls, there is 1/3 of the 2/5 that signed up to play outfield.
The answer can be solved with multiplication of fractions.
2/5 * 1/3 is 2/15. So 2/15 of the girls in the school signed up to play outfield.
Answer: 2/15 or 0.133
